From bdab0409c4e47a2df112196de915a06d208293ce Mon Sep 17 00:00:00 2001 From: ringmaster Date: Thu, 5 Dec 2013 09:19:46 -0500 Subject: [PATCH 1/6] Add overlay noscript message to fix #6032 --- core/css/styles.css | 21 +++++++++++++++++++++ core/templates/layout.user.php | 1 + 2 files changed, 22 insertions(+) diff --git a/core/css/styles.css b/core/css/styles.css index fa001d41c2c..0ed4cf36c91 100644 --- a/core/css/styles.css +++ b/core/css/styles.css @@ -46,6 +46,27 @@ body { background:#fefefe; font:normal .8em/1.6em "Helvetica Neue",Helvetica,Ari opacity: 1; } +#nojavascript { + position: absolute; + top: 0; + bottom: 0; + z-index: 999; + width: 100%; + text-align: center; + background-color: rgba(50,0,0,0.5); + color: white; + text-shadow: 0px 0px 5px black; + line-height: 125%; + font-size: x-large; +} +#nojavascript div { + width: 50%; + top: 50%; + position: absolute; + left: 50%; + margin-left: -25%; +} + /* INPUTS */ input[type="text"], input[type="password"], diff --git a/core/templates/layout.user.php b/core/templates/layout.user.php index 9e1d8022ecb..7492af799b3 100644 --- a/core/templates/layout.user.php +++ b/core/templates/layout.user.php @@ -37,6 +37,7 @@ +
From 38745e4bd11327bcd0b280a2241cd02b8d421b84 Mon Sep 17 00:00:00 2001 From: ringmaster Date: Thu, 5 Dec 2013 09:48:20 -0500 Subject: [PATCH 2/6] Move message up 10% --- core/css/styles.css |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/core/css/styles.css b/core/css/styles.css index 0ed4cf36c91..53cce7b733b 100644 --- a/core/css/styles.css +++ b/core/css/styles.css @@ -61,7 +61,7 @@ body { background:#fefefe; font:normal .8em/1.6em "Helvetica Neue",Helvetica,Ari } #nojavascript div { width: 50%; - top: 50%; + top: 40%; position: absolute; left: 50%; margin-left: -25%; From 1687ec0cd2f2f615cf4e6fe42d0d684ca7ce6067 Mon Sep 17 00:00:00 2001 From: ringmaster Date: Thu, 5 Dec 2013 09:52:13 -0500 Subject: [PATCH 3/6] Make noscript message translatable --- core/templates/layout.user.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/core/templates/layout.user.php b/core/templates/layout.user.php index 7492af799b3..3aef3ecd047 100644 --- a/core/templates/layout.user.php +++ b/core/templates/layout.user.php @@ -37,7 +37,7 @@ - +
From e7748613eff294113eb2039b46ddeb5beb6ac88e Mon Sep 17 00:00:00 2001 From: ringmaster Date: Thu, 5 Dec 2013 12:06:20 -0500 Subject: [PATCH 4/6] Link to enable-javascript.com --- core/css/styles.css | 7 +++++++ core/templates/layout.user.php | 2 +- 2 files changed, 8 insertions(+), 1 deletion(-) diff --git a/core/css/styles.css b/core/css/styles.css index 53cce7b733b..2a86b026597 100644 --- a/core/css/styles.css +++ b/core/css/styles.css @@ -66,6 +66,13 @@ body { background:#fefefe; font:normal .8em/1.6em "Helvetica Neue",Helvetica,Ari left: 50%; margin-left: -25%; } +#nojavascript a { + color: #ccc; + text-decoration: underline; +} +#nojavascript a:hover { + color: #aaa; +} /* INPUTS */ input[type="text"], diff --git a/core/templates/layout.user.php b/core/templates/layout.user.php index 3aef3ecd047..a782c69156c 100644 --- a/core/templates/layout.user.php +++ b/core/templates/layout.user.php @@ -37,7 +37,7 @@ - +
From 1dc9998920f7b0dcb85e019e69d75fb71cf3d897 Mon Sep 17 00:00:00 2001 From: ringmaster Date: Thu, 5 Dec 2013 17:01:51 -0500 Subject: [PATCH 5/6] Remove reference to ownCloud. --- core/templates/layout.user.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/core/templates/layout.user.php b/core/templates/layout.user.php index a782c69156c..45b7e39686d 100644 --- a/core/templates/layout.user.php +++ b/core/templates/layout.user.php @@ -37,7 +37,7 @@ - +
From 3444c15b8699d4199843830755e815f320467602 Mon Sep 17 00:00:00 2001 From: Morris Jobke Date: Sat, 7 Dec 2013 17:03:53 +0100 Subject: [PATCH 6/6] fix IE8 transparent background --- core/css/fixes.css |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/core/css/fixes.css b/core/css/fixes.css index 3cdeccb0387..bec002b96b3 100644 --- a/core/css/fixes.css +++ b/core/css/fixes.css @@ -58,3 +58,8 @@ .ie9 #navigation { width: 100px; } + +/* IE8 isn't able to display transparent background. So it is specified using a gradient */ +.ie8 #nojavascript { + filter: progid:DXImageTransform.Microsoft.gradient(GradientType=0,startColorstr='#4c320000', endColorstr='#4c320000'); /* IE */ +}